Global E&C to provide engineering services for two Bluewater floaters

Global E&C has won an engineering and modification support services contract for Bluewater’s FPSOs Aoka Mizu and Haewene Brim, both currently operating in the UK North Sea.   The three-year contract carries two options for single-year extensions.   Formed last year, Global E&C supports brownfield…

Woodfibre LNG granted 5-year extension

Woodfibre LNG has received a five-year extension from the British Columbia Environmental Assessment Office to begin construction on its 2.1-million tonne/year liquefaction plant.   The new deadline is the 26th October 2025.   The company had hoped to begin construction this summer but filed a…
